Wasim Akram’s Enduring Legacy as Mitchell Starc Breaks Test Wicket Record

Cricket enthusiasts worldwide have recently turned their attention to a significant milestone in Test cricket, as Australian pacer Mitchell Starc surpassed the long-standing record held by Pakistans iconic left-arm fast bowler, वसीम अकरम. This achievement marks a new chapter in the history of the sport, celebrating the prowess of left-arm pacers who have consistently left an indelible mark on the game.
For decades, वसीम अकरम was synonymous with left-arm fast bowling. Known as the ‘Sultan of Swing,’ his ability to move the ball both ways, combined with his mastery of reverse swing, made him one of the most feared bowlers of his era. Akrams career was punctuated by numerous match-winning performances and a remarkable tally of wickets across all formats, cementing his place as a true legend of the sport.
Mitchell Starcs recent accomplishment, becoming the most successful left-arm fast bowler in Test cricket history by surpassing वसीम अकरमs wicket count, is a testament to his consistent performance and dedication. Starc, with his raw pace and ability to generate steep bounce, has been a cornerstone of Australias Test attack for many years. His relentless pursuit of wickets and his crucial contributions to his teams successes have earned him widespread acclaim.
While records are made to be broken, the context of such achievements often sparks healthy debate and reflection on the careers of those involved. वसीम अकरमs 414 Test wickets as a left-arm pacer stood as a benchmark for an exceptionally long time. This record highlighted his remarkable longevity and effectiveness in the demanding format of Test cricket. His impact extended beyond statistics, influencing a generation of fast bowlers with his innovative techniques and aggressive approach.
